Output e4291d27e3efd3941dbf6c59360928fda6658a0128325987975219cdf249a340:71

value
583887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22674d7f2fecaf98051dbcea0a9671ba9ae127ab OP_EQUAL
address
34pvefX7vHv3VUYhTWvmUkyzHrcBH4DMj4
transaction
e4291d27e3efd3941dbf6c59360928fda6658a0128325987975219cdf249a340
spent
true